ALBUQUERQUE, N.M. – Nevada Softball's final two games of its series at New Mexico have been pushed forward an hour in an attempt to avoid high winds at Lobo Softball Field.
Saturday's game is now set for 1 p.m. MT/12 p.m. PT as the Pack looks to take its seventh straight series in conference play. Nevada can clinch a first-round bye at the Mountain West Championships with a win and two losses by Fresno State in its doubleheader at Colorado State, Saturday.
Sunday's series finale will start at 11 a.m. MT/10 a.m., the final regular season road game for the Pack.
